C# 在reportViewer中手动配置TableAdapter的connectionString
嘿 我使用创建了一个reportViewer,并希望通过代码更改tableAdapter的connectionString。该字符串将在运行时更改,并存储在settings.xml文件中C# 在reportViewer中手动配置TableAdapter的connectionString,c#,reportviewer,C#,Reportviewer,嘿 我使用创建了一个reportViewer,并希望通过代码更改tableAdapter的connectionString。该字符串将在运行时更改,并存储在settings.xml文件中 有人能帮我吗?您应该能够将TableAdapter的ConnectionModifier设置为public,然后访问其ConnectionString属性 DataSet1TableAdapters.TestTableAdapter testTableAdapter = new DataSet1TableAda
有人能帮我吗?您应该能够将TableAdapter的ConnectionModifier设置为public,然后访问其ConnectionString属性
DataSet1TableAdapters.TestTableAdapter testTableAdapter = new DataSet1TableAdapters.WagesTableAdapter();
testTableAdapter.Connection.ConnectionString = "someconnectionstring";
我的计算方法是使用相同的xsd列,列的名称必须相同,这样我只使用了一个表来生成更多的报表,但在这个表中,所有报表都需要这些列如果您使用的是服务器报表,则可以使用Expression来构建数据源连接字符串,并使用参数构建此表达式。 所以,为服务器、数据库添加参数。。等 然后可以将连接字符串从代码发送到这些参数 您可以在本文中找到更多详细信息
这就是问题所在…我不能这样做…我有一个数据集和表适配器,不知何故,我需要将数据集和表适配器与给定的连接字符串相关联…并且不使用设计器。。。。我想从代码开始